6 Easy ways to increase sales at Christmas

Retail at Christmas time

We are only 9 weeks away from the biggest time of the year for retail. Christmas is a crazy time of year and nowhere is more crazy than retail.

To survive the silly season, it’s important to have a strategy and to re-focus on the things that will make a difference for you, and your team.

We've pulled out six tips from our retail sales training (that are completely free) to help your team survive and smash your budgets.

  • SMILING: We've talked about this before but research shows that smiling makes you feel good and it makes the people around you feel good too. Customers cope with the pressures of parking, queues and financial stress better if they’re dealing with retailers that smile because they’ll receive a multitude of benefits. Some of which are: lowering blood pressure, boosting immunity and a release of endorphins into the body.
  • BEING ON TIME: There’s something to be said for feeling organised and on top of things when you start your day. It helps to make you feel like you’re in control and lowers your stress levels so that you’re better able to deal with the extra volume of customers coming through the door. Don't start the day hurrying through the door, apologising for being late.
  • GOING THE EXTRA MILE: Customers always love it when you go the extra mile, especially at Christmas time. Finding a product at another store, helping a customer get purchases to the car, or gift wrapping all make a difference and make you, and your store, stand out!
  • ENERGY LEVELS: Good energy levels equals a good vibe. It’s as simple as that. Make sure your team is kept well fed and watered over this crazy time of the year. They’ll need it to keep up their energy. They’ll need a rest, both from being on their feet and from the constant contact with people. Here’s a Top Tip: Shout your team some snacks on a busy day, this will keep their energy levels up and overall boost morale.
  • ATTITUDE: A great attitude from your whole team will help you get through all the tricky situations that Christmas brings, from running out of key lines, EFTPOS systems going down, sick team members and the rest! Operating above the line is always a choice and it’s something that you have to reinforce with your team daily. Some ways to keep everyone's attitudes in the green is to have a daily huddle before each shift and check-in with your team members. Share daily goals and targets, recap on the previous day's activity and ensure everyone is on the same page.
  • PASSION: A passionate sales person often trumps a knowledgeable and skilled salesperson. We’re drawn to passionate people because they put 100% into what they love. Passion can’t be faked, it’s genuine and authentic, so encourage your team to be enthusiastic with customers, to enjoy the season and to have fun!

If you want to make the most of this year’s lead-up to Christmas trade, look after your team and encourage and challenge them to bring their A-game to work. If you have to be there, you may as well enjoy it!
